    The largest charging operators, Estonia's Enefit and Eleport, as well as Elektrum and Ignitis ON, owned by the Latvian and Lithuanian state electricity companies, are constantly building new fast 50–100 kW and ultra-fast 150–400 kW charging stations across Estonia. These are being installed both. EV charging in Estonia has grown rapidly in recent years. Public charging points are available across the country, and major networks such as Alexela, Circle K and Enefit offer both fast and standard chargers. Log in or register and start charging. This guide gives you the practical details. The following connector types are common in Estonia: Most new public chargers use CCS2 for DC fast charging and Type 2 for AC charging.

    Until the mid-1990s, the power sector in Salvador operated through the government owned Comisión Hidroeléctrica del Río Lempa (CEL), which provided generation, transmission and distribution services. The electricity sector restructuring that led to the unbundling of electricity generation, transmission and distribution and the horizontal division of generation and distribution into several companies was carried out in the period 1996-2000.
